Acronym: COMPARE-Rad
Brief Summary: This trial will compare the procedural success rate between right and left radial approach in patients undergoing coronary angiography and coronary intervention.
Detailed Description: The three operators who are proficient in the left radial approach for coronary angiography and coronary intervention will be assigned to the right radial approach for 3 months (phase 1). After then, these three operators will switch approach site to the left radial for another 3 months (phase 2).

Procedural success, time of the procedure, use of contrast agent, and fluoroscopic data will be compared between right radial approach (phase 1) group and left radial approach (phase 2).
